Chip Hale Biography and Career:

In 2023, legendary former Arizona Wildcat player and coach Chip Hale will begin his second year at the helm of the program that bears his name. On July 5, 2021, Vice President and Director of Athletics Dave Heeke announced him as the next head coach of the Arizona baseball team. On July 7, 2021, he was formally presented at a press conference.

Hale, who played for the Wildcats in Tucson from 1984 to 1987 and held the school records for games played, hits, and total bases, has returned to Arizona after almost two decades as a professional coach. He’s the Wildcats’ sixth modern-era and seventeenth overall head coach.

After spending 2021 as the third base coach for the Detroit Tigers, Hale has relocated back to Tucson. Hale has been a central league head coach for 15 years, with stops including Detroit, the Washington Nationals (2018-20), the Oakland Athletics (2012-14, 2017), the Arizona Diamondbacks (2007-09, 2015-16), and the New York Mets (2010-11).

Hale will be the next head baseball coach at the University of Arizona in July 2021. Hale’s tenure as manager of the Arizona Diamondbacks in 2015 and 2016 was the highlight of his fifteen years in Major League Baseball. As D-backs manager, he oversaw a winning record of over 150 games and guided the careers of superstars like Paul Goldschmidt and A.J. Pollock. In 2015, his first season with the D-backs, the franchise’s batting average, runs scored, hits, doubles, triples, home runs, stolen bases, OBP, and slugging % all ranked in the top three in the National League.

Before coming to Detroit in 2018, Hale spent the previous three years (2018-20) as the bench coach for the Washington Nationals. The 2019 World Series triumph was the crowning achievement of his tenure in the nation’s capital.

With Hale at the helm, players like Bryce Harper, Juan Soto, Trea Turner, Anthony Rendon, Matt Chapman, Paul Goldschmidt, Zack Greinke, Josh Donaldson, Dan Haren, and Justin Upton flourished under his tutelage.

In 2004 and 2005, Hale was the manager of the Triple-A Tucson Sidewinders when he began his professional coaching career. After a stellar minor league career, Hale was named Pacific Coast League Manager of the Year in 2006 after leading the Sidewinders to a 91-53 record and the league championship.

The renowned infielder played four years with the Wildcats, earning a 1986 NCAA title, 1987 Pac-10 South Player of the Year accolades, 1987 Tom Hansen Medal honors, and First Team All-Pac-10 South honors. He participated in 255 games throughout his tenure with Arizona and set the franchise marks for at-bats (978), hits (337), runs (162), and total bases (507) in those categories. In 1994, Hale was honored with induction into Arizona’s Sports Hall of Fame.

Hale was picked by the Minnesota Twins in the 17th round of the 1987 Major League Baseball Draft after an impressive college career. After that, he had a successful Major League career with the Minnesota Twins and the Los Angeles Dodgers that lasted seven years.

Arizona’s first season with Hale at the helm was a huge success, with the Wildcats making their 41st appearance in the NCAA Tournament and winning two elimination games in the NCAA Coral Gables Regional. Only four first-year head coaches in the whole nation, including Hale, qualified for the 2022 NCAA Tournament.

The Wildcats beat Kansas State 8-6 on February 18, 2022, giving coach Hale his first win in charge. Arizona ended the season with a 39-25 overall record and a 17-15 conference mark, both winning spots.

After the season, two of Hale’s Wildcats were selected in the Major League Baseball Draft. Oakland Athletics catcher and all-star Daniel Susac was taken 19th overall, making him the 12th player in school history to be selected in the first round of the MLB draft. Tanner O’Tremba, an outfielder named All-Pac-12, was drafted by the San Francisco Giants in the 15th round.

Arizona’s 2022 success on the field resulted from a well-rounded strategy emphasizing hitting, pitching, and defense. When the season was through, the Wildcats’ offense placed in the top four in the Pac-12 in runs scored, hits, triples, home runs, RBI, walks, total bases, and extra-base hits. Arizona scored over 6.5 runs per game on average, thanks to the efforts of players like Susac, O’Tremba, Chase Davis, Garen Caulfield, and others.

With Hale as his manager, Susac amassed 100 hits, tying for sixth in the country and making him the 10th player in school history to have a 100-hit campaign. The 2022 Arizona Wildcats lead the Pac-12 with 26 triples, the most in the league since the team relocated to Hi Corbett in 2012.

The Wildcat’s defense also improved dramatically during the year, culminating in a season-ending fielding .972% was five points better than the previous year’s record and the Wildcats’ best defensive performance since 2018. The ’22 Cats were also very good at turning double plays, finishing the year rated fourth in the country with 57.

Regarding pitching, Arizona had two players named to the Pac-12’s All-Conference team. Right-handed Quinn Flanagan became the first Wildcat bullpen pitcher to be named to the First Team Pac-12 All-Conference since 2016, while southpaw Garrett Irvin received the first all-conference distinction of his career.
